Saville (Tractors) of Stratford-on-Avon

1942 Private company.

1961 Engineers and distributors of industrial earth moving and construction machinery, and agricultural implements and tractors. 400 employees.

c.1975 Acquired by Dutton-Forshaw Group[1]
